Lawmakers return to state capitol this week

CHARLESTON, W.Va. — State lawmakers have three days of monthly interim committee meetings beginning Monday at state capitol.

Several topics are on the agendas of various committees including pay increases for county elected officials, an update on the WVU College of Law and discussion about funding county boards of education.

Lawmakers also have interim meetings scheduled for early December and in January just before the beginning of the 60-day legislative session.
